Please leave us a message here if you are interested in our services or would like to know more about our company.
We will soon be in touch.
London
68 Hanbury St
E1 5JL London, UK
Lisbon
Mercado de Ribeira, Av. 24 de Julho
1200-479 Lisboa, Portugal
Singapore
83 Clemenceau Avenue
Singapore 239920, Singapore